Iratus: Lord of the Dead

A true masterpiece!

At first, it looks like the Darkest Dungeon. But balance and fighting system is pretty far from it. Base is different. You can passively upgrade a backup units during the game. Or you can win the game with only one party. Your units have only a health, while enemies also have a mental bar. And the best thing is - it's faster! You don't have to wait for unit replica all the time. But you also don't need to turn it off. The game speed is just perfect. It may be less complicated then DD as well, but much more attractive and involving. Therefore, more playable. Also, you play as a necromancer. Which is just evil. Not seeking for the revenge for a past life events, not good and fluffy deep inside. Just evil. This is awesome.

Silence

Interactive movie

It's beautiful. I played demo and loved it. Then bought full version and was disappointed. Because: • It is short • It cost too much for such short and plain game • It's more an interactive movie, than a point and click game. There's not much things to point and click on. Most of the time you just click on dialog choices, which don't change anything. • Loading screens in 2017. For almost still landscapes. Really? • There are no inventory, because you don't carry things. You don't need it in the movie. • There are no even mid-tier puzzles. More like a situations, you can resolve with one or two clicks. If it requires more clicks, it does not mean you have to think or guess. It's just more clicks. • A few logical errors in puzzles
